A little known fact from the early days of the Negro Leagues is that the umpires were white! It was not until Rube Foster decided to go with a crew of skilled black umpires that the league broke down another barrier in baseball history. The first to do so and the man leading the charge was former player Billy Donaldson. Here we see the pioneer in his uniform on the field ready to take on the challenge of another game.
